The Best Model Is a Routing Decision
Blog post from Speedscale
NVIDIA’s Nemotron developments illustrate a broader shift in AI application design from relying on a single flagship model to routing individual tasks among specialized local, low-cost, and frontier models based on capability, latency, cost, privacy, and safety needs. The text highlights Nemotron 3 VoiceChat’s sub-300-millisecond full-duplex conversational target as an example of how responsiveness can shape product usability as much as answer quality, while Nemotron 3 Super and related models emphasize efficient specialized performance rather than universal benchmark leadership. It argues that frontier models will increasingly serve as escalation options for difficult cases, with routing approaches such as RouteLLM suggesting potential cost savings for suitable workloads. Local deployment is presented not only as an economic choice but also as a means of retaining control over sensitive data, model configurations, and operational continuity. As AI makes code generation more accessible, the central engineering challenge becomes building and operating a reliable “software factory” that supplies agents with context, assigns work appropriately, verifies outputs against real conditions, and manages security, deployment, observability, and changing dependencies.
